git怎么更新其他的分支并合并

fiy 其他 123

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要更新其他的分支并合并,可以按照以下步骤进行操作:

    1. 首先,切换到当前分支的工作目录下,确保当前分支是最新的状态。可以使用以下命令来拉取最新的提交:

    “`
    git pull origin [当前分支]
    “`

    2. 确保已经切换到要更新的分支。可以使用以下命令来切换到目标分支:

    “`
    git checkout [目标分支]
    “`

    3. 接下来,更新目标分支的代码。可以使用以下命令来拉取最新的提交:

    “`
    git pull origin [目标分支]
    “`

    4. 现在,将目标分支合并到当前分支。可以使用以下命令来合并分支:

    “`
    git merge [目标分支]
    “`

    注意:在合并分支之前,应该确保当前分支没有未提交的修改。如果有未提交的修改,可以先提交或者保存现场,然后再进行合并操作。

    5. 合并完成后,可以使用以下命令来推送更新到远程仓库:

    “`
    git push origin [当前分支]
    “`

    注意:如果在切换分支、拉取更新或合并过程中有冲突产生,需要解决冲突后再进行推送操作。

    以上就是更新其他分支并合并的步骤。根据具体的情况,可能需要在执行这些命令之前先执行一些其他的操作,比如保存现场、解决冲突等。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要更新其他分支并将其合并到当前分支,可以按照以下步骤进行操作:

    1. 确保当前分支干净:在更新和合并其他分支之前,确保当前分支没有未提交的更改。可以使用`git status`命令查看当前分支的状态。

    2. 切换到要合并的分支:使用`git checkout`命令切换到要合并的分支。例如,要切换到名为`feature`的分支,可以运行`git checkout feature`。

    3. 更新分支:在切换到要合并的分支后,可以使用`git pull`命令将远程分支的最新更改拉取到本地分支。例如,要更新并拉取`origin/feature`分支的更改,可以运行`git pull origin feature`。

    4. 切回到当前分支:更新和合并其他分支后,使用`git checkout`命令切换回当前分支。例如,如果当前分支是`main`,可以运行`git checkout main`。

    5. 合并其他分支:在切回当前分支后,可以使用`git merge`命令将更新的分支合并到当前分支。例如,要将`feature`分支合并到当前分支,可以运行`git merge feature`。

    需要注意的是,有时候合并分支可能会引起冲突,需要手动解决冲突后再提交。另外,建议在合并分支前先进行测试,确保代码的稳定性和正确性。

    总结起来,更新其他分支并将其合并到当前分支的步骤如下:
    1. 确保当前分支干净。
    2. 切换到要合并的分支。
    3. 更新分支。
    4. 切回到当前分支。
    5. 合并其他分支。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    更新其他分支并合并可以通过以下几个步骤完成:

    1. 查看当前分支以及其他分支的情况:
    使用`git branch`命令可以查看当前仓库中的所有分支,用`git status`命令可以查看当前所在分支的状态。

    2. 切换到需要合并的分支:
    使用`git checkout`命令加上分支名可以切换到目标分支。例如,使用`git checkout branchA`可以切换到`branchA`分支。

    3. 更新目标分支:
    在目标分支中,运行`git pull`命令来从远程仓库拉取最新的提交。如果是更新本地分支,可以使用`git fetch`命令加上远程分支名来获取远程分支上的提交,然后再使用`git merge`命令合并分支。

    4. 合并分支:
    完成更新后,在目标分支上运行`git merge`命令来合并其他分支。例如,如果要将`branchA`合并到当前分支,可以在当前分支上运行`git merge branchA`命令。

    5. 解决冲突:
    如果在合并过程中出现冲突,则需要手动解决冲突。使用`git status`命令可以查看冲突文件列表,然后使用文本编辑器打开这些文件,解决冲突并保存。

    6. 提交合并结果:
    解决冲突后,使用`git add`命令将修改的文件添加到暂存区,然后使用`git commit`命令提交合并结果。

    综上所述,更新其他分支并合并的步骤如下:
    1. 切换到目标分支;
    2. 更新目标分支;
    3. 合并其他分支;
    4. 解决冲突;
    5. 提交合并结果。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部